2. Popular Bunk Bed Designs
Bunk beds come in a wide array of designs dealing with various tastes and requirements. Here are some popular designs found in the UK market:
Design Type | Description |
---|---|
Traditional Wooden | Classic style; offered in various finishes; durable and timeless. |
Metal Bunk Beds | Lightweight, frequently with a modern or industrial look; easy to move. |
Loft Beds | Raised beds that offer underneath space for desks, storage, or play. |
Futon Bunk Beds | A combination of a futon and bunk bed; perfect for multi-purpose spaces. |
L-Shaped Bunk Beds | Two beds positioned in an L-shape; great for maximizing corner spaces. |

4. Safety Considerations
When it pertains to bunk beds, safety is critical, specifically for more youthful kids. Here are some vital security ideas:
- Choose durable building and construction: Look for bunk beds made from solid wood or heavy-duty metal to make sure resilience.
- Make sure proper height: The leading bunk should adhere to safety standards, normally having at least 16 inches of guardrail on the side.
- Inspect weight limitations: Ensure the bunk bed supports the weight of the intended users easily.
- Utilize the best mattresses: Use bed mattress sizes that fit comfortably within the bed frame to prevent spaces where a child might become trapped.
- Develop rules: Make sure kids understand the rules of bed use, such as no jumping and only one individual on the top bunk.

6. FAQs
Q1: What age appropriates for kids to oversleep bunk beds?A1: Most
experts advise that kids under the age of six need to not sleep on the top bunk due to safety issues regarding falls.
Q2: Can bunk beds fit in any room size?A2: While bunk beds
